About Hooksway

Hooksway is a small South Downs village in West Sussex, reached via the A286 from Chichester or the A3/A286 route from London through Hindhead. Local roads connect to nearby Marden villages and the B2141 heads east toward Petersfield. The settlement's name comes from an ancient drovers' route where shepherds would "hook" around the steeper downland slopes whilst moving their flocks.
